论文题名:
面向耦合器C-Coupler2的可视化系统

中文摘要: 地球系统模式是开展气候变化研究与无缝隙天气预报的基础软件之一。耦合器实现了地球系统模式中分量模式之间的协作,是实现地球系统模式的系统集成和模块化的关键。为了使用户能便捷地开展耦合模式的构建,且能了解分量模式间的耦合关系,该文以中国最新研制的自主耦合器C-Coupler2为基础平台,研究了面向耦合器操作的可视化技术,实现了C-Coupler2耦合配置文件的可视化显示构建,以及分量模式间耦合关系的交互式可视化显示。该工作提高了C-Coupler2的用户友好性,使C-Coupler2成为第一个具有可视化支持的自主耦合器。
英文摘要: The earth system models (ESMs) are the basic tools used for climate change research and unseamable weather forecasting. The coupler connects the components in the ESMs and is the key to integrating and the modular development of the ESMs. This paper presents a visualization of the coupler operation based on the C-Coupler2 developed in China. The visualization facilitates coupling construction and the coupling connections among components. The system allows visual display and construction of the C-Coupler2 coupling configuration file and an interactive display of the C-Coupler2 coupling connections among components. This improves the user friendliness of C-Coupler2 and makes C-Coupler2 the first autonomous coupler with visual support.
